file-type

编码规范与Git命令指南

ZIP文件

下载需积分: 5 | 6KB | 更新于2024-12-14 | 174 浏览量 | 0 下载量 举报 收藏
download 立即下载
编码标准和命名约定: PascalCasing是微软编码标准中常用的一种命名规范,其主要规则是将每个单词的首字母大写,其余字母小写,并且命名不使用下划线分隔符,适用于类名和方法名。例如,类名为"Customer",方法名为"AddCustomer"。 camelCasing与PascalCasing类似,不同之处在于camelCasing将第一个单词的首字母也小写。这种命名约定通常用于方法参数和局部变量,以增强代码的可读性。例如,方法参数可以命名为"customerName",局部变量可以命名为"customer"。 在私有变量前加上下划线,这在某些编程风格中是常见的做法,目的是为了区分私有成员和公共成员。在类的内部,可以通过一个下划线前缀来明确指出某个变量或方法是为类的内部使用设计的,比如"_privateVariable"。 在接口命名中使用字母I作为前缀,这是.NET编程中一个常见的约定,用以区分接口和类。例如,接口名可能为"IUserService",而实现该接口的类名可能是"UserService"。 垂直对齐花括号是代码风格中的一个约定,它要求代码中的花括号应该垂直对齐,以提高代码的整洁性和可读性。 注释应该单独占据一行,不应与代码混合。这样的规则有助于保持代码的整洁,同时便于阅读和维护。单行注释一般使用"//",多行注释则使用"/* ... */"。 基本的git命令: git pull是组合命令,它等同于先执行git fetch命令获取远程仓库的最新更改,再执行git merge命令将这些更改合并到当前分支中。 git push命令用于将本地仓库中的提交发送到远程仓库。它是版本控制系统中进行协作和代码共享的关键操作。 git fetch命令用于从远程仓库获取最新的更改,并将这些更改存储在本地仓库中,但不会自动合并到工作分支。这个操作是安全的,因为它不会影响你的工作目录。 git merge命令用于将远程分支的更改整合到当前分支中。在执行此命令前通常需要先执行git fetch。 git commit命令用于记录对存储库的更改。在执行此命令时可以配合参数使用。如"-a"参数表示将所有更改过的文件加入到暂存区,而"-m"参数后面通常跟随一条消息,说明这次提交的目的。 git add命令用于将指定的文件添加到暂存区,以便在下次提交时将这些更改记录到仓库中。"git add -A"命令相当于"git add .",它会添加所有当前目录及其子目录下更改过的文件到暂存区。 git status命令显示当前工作树的状态,包括哪些文件被修改过,哪些还没有被暂存,以及哪些还没有被跟踪。 典型的git工作流程: 一般的git工作流程开始于从远程仓库获取最新的更改,即执行"git pull"。之后开发者在本地仓库进行更改,然后将这些更改通过"git add"添加到暂存区,最后通过"git commit"将更改记录到本地仓库。在准备将更改共享到远程仓库之前,可以再次使用"git pull"确保本地仓库是最新的。如果有冲突则需要解决,否则可以使用"git push"将更改推送到远程仓库。

相关推荐

戴剑松
  • 粉丝: 37
上传资源 快速赚钱